Understanding Nebido Dosage: A Comprehensive Guide

Nebido is a long-acting testosterone replacement therapy used to treat men with low testosterone levels. It is important for patients to understand the correct dosage to ensure effective treatment and minimize potential side effects.

Recommended Dosage

Typically, the administration of Nebido is carried out every 10 to 14 weeks. However, the specific dosage may vary depending on individual needs and the advice of a healthcare professional. Below are the general guidelines:

  1. Initial Dose: The initial dosage for adults is usually 1000 mg, administered intramuscularly.
  2. Subsequent Doses: After the initial administration, Nebido can be given every 10 to 14 weeks, depending on the patient’s testosterone levels and overall treatment response.
  3. Monitoring: Regular monitoring of testosterone levels is crucial to adjust the dosage as needed to achieve optimal results.

Factors Influencing Dosage

Several factors can influence the appropriate dosage of Nebido, including:

  • Age: Older patients may require different treatment considerations.
  • Body Weight: Dosing may be adjusted based on the patient’s weight and muscle mass.
  • Health Status: Pre-existing health conditions may necessitate changes in dosage.

Possible Side Effects

While Nebido is effective for many men, it can lead to potential side effects that should be monitored. Common side effects include:

  • Acne or oily skin
  • Increased blood pressure
  • Changes in mood or anxiety levels
  • Increased red blood cell count
